Title: Bounty -- cgminer Litecoin GPU mining on OSX
Post by: bitcoinraffle.co on August 16, 2012, 03:05:53 PM
I'm trying like crazy to get cgminer working on my macs.  I got it to compile, but it just sits there when I run it with the --scrypt option.  It works just fine if I try to mine Bitcoin with it.  If I enter the correct parameters for Litecoin, it doesn't do anything.  

I'll pay 500 LTC to anyone who can solve the problem... or more if it's actually going to take any work.

My terminal window looks like this when I run it with --scrypt:

http://i48.tinypic.com/25uk228.png


Title: Re: Bounty -- cgminer Litecoin GPU mining on OSX
Post by: bitcoinraffle.co on August 21, 2012, 07:41:38 PM
Never mind. I upgraded to Mountain Lion, and it works just fine now.
